    First published in 1874 Les Diaboliques caused an uproar and all the copies were seized on the orders of the Ministry of Justice as the book was a danger to public morality. Scandal made the book an immediate success. One hundred and thirty years later it is now firmly established as a classic and studied in French schools.     Henri René Albert Guy de Maupassant; (5 August 1850 – 6 July 1893) was a popular French writer, considered one of the fathers of the modern short story and one of the form's finest exponents.
